He pencilled the first half of the series and issue 380 (which is done entirely as splash panels). Sal Buscema pencilled the rest after staring with the Balder the Brave spinoff miniseries.
Walter Simonson's "Ragnarok" series from IDW Comics is another book that approaches Norse myth in a different light. Simonson is, for the uninitiated, the writer and (co-)penciller of a character-redefining run on Marvel's "The Mighty Thor" in the 1980s.
